27 April. Friday night’s first After-Party will be started by the legendary Afrojack, Grammy Award-winning recording artist, producer, and DJ. Known as a versatile producer and music artist who is able to move effortlessly across genres from electronic music to hip-hop and pop, he is as respected and known for his work producing tracks for other artists as much as he is known for his own music. Just some of the tracks he has helped produce include Beyonce’s Run The World (Girls), Madonna’s Revolver with David Guetta and Ne-Yo and Pitbull’s Give Me Everything. In 2018 alone, Afrojack has released an array of diverse hits such as Bad Company with DirtCaps, Helium by teaming up again with David Guetta and Sia, and a remix of U2’s iconic Get Out Of Your Own Way. He continues to work a lot with his good friend David Guetta, and later this year they will perform in Ibiza together. Afrojack also released two hits last year with David Guetta, Another Life featuring Ester Dean and the star-studded Dirty Sexy Money with Charli XCX and French Montana. Afrojack won a Grammy for his 2011 remix of Madonna’s Revolver (David Guetta's One Love Club Remix) shared with David Guetta for the Best Remixed Recording, Non-Classical. He’s been nominated a total of 4 times for remixing Collide with Leona Lewis; producing Look at Me Now with Chris Brown and producing Give Me Everything with Ne-Yo, Pitbull, and Nayer. Afrojack recently returned back home to Wynn Las Vegas for his 2018 residency and performed twice at this year’s Ultra Miami for their 20th anniversary where he brought out special guest VASSY to perform their recent hit LOST featuring Oliver Rosa. 28 April. Saturday night will see two of Sweden’s most exciting musical exports and leading figures in the electronic dance music scene - Axwell Λ Ingrosso¬ - keep the adrenaline flowing into the early hours of the morning. The iconic reign of Axwell and Sebastian Ingrosso – founding members of the legendary Swedish House Mafia - took new heights in the form of Axwell Λ Ingrosso. Embraced by tastemakers, luxury brands and adoring fans across the continents, a culmination of Grammy Nominations, DJ Mag Top 100 chart success and back-to-back Billboard and Beatport chart accession has seen the duo garner huge attention from across the globe. From landmark appearances at Coachella, V Festival and Electronic Daisy Carnival and a weekly summer residency at the prestigious Ushuaia Ibiza under their belts, the year ahead spells more high-profile activity for two Sweden’s hottest musical exports of the last decade. 29 April. The weekend will be closed out by none other than legendary DJ, Martin Solveig who will take to the stage right after Dua Lipa has finished her post-race set to make sure the F1 weekend keeps going just a little bit longer! The global multi-platinum selling Parisian artist has achieved phenomenal success in his 20 years as a DJ, producer, and songwriter and still continues to push the boundaries of music with his pioneering ideas. It was Solveig’s single ‘Hello’, featuring Canadian electropop outfit Dragonette, that really launched the Frenchman into superstardom in 2010. The infectious lead track from his album ‘Smash’ charted at #1 in 4 countries and caught the attention of Madonna, who then recruited Solveig to co-produce six tracks on her album, ‘MDNA’. Solveig also accompanied the Queen of Pop on her worldwide tour in 2012. In 2015, Solveig released his single ‘Intoxicated’ which peaked in the Top 5 of the UK official singles chart and remained there for 24 consecutive weeks and received platinum and gold certifications across Europe. 2016 saw the release of ‘Do It Right’ featuring Tkay Maidza. Another upbeat anthem underneath his belt, the single was used as the soundtrack to Stuart Weitzman’s Fall 2016 campaign, starring supermodel Gigi Hadid and directed by the multi-talented James Franco. Currently working in the studio with the likes of Oliver Heldens, Tiga and Clean Bandit, Solveig continues to build on his stellar reputation as a truly multi-faceted artist.
